The School of Nursing at the University of Medicine and Dentistry of New Jersey (UMDNJ) provides unique opportunities in teaching, scholarship, clinical practice and multidisciplinary collaboration.

Innovative academic offerings include bachelor's, master's, post-master's and doctoral degree programs that are preparing nurse leaders of today and tomorrow. Centers at the school offer continuing education, advance the practice of nursing, promote cultural competency in healthcare, and provide education, training and healthcare services nationally and internationally to fight HIV/AIDS. Outreach programs include a mobile healthcare clinic serving cities in northern NJ and a community health center in the southern part of the state.

Clinical Placement Coordinator

Job # 12NS962781 UMDNJ-School of Nursing (Newark & Stratford, NJ)

SUMMARY
Under the supervision of the Assistant Dean for Graduate Programs, this individual will assist graduate nursing students to secure clinical placement sites to meet the educational requirements of the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) program at UMDNJ.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include:

  1. Project student clinical placement needs in collaboration with graduate faculty.
  2. Identify clinical sites that meet the educational needs of the various specialty tracks.
  3. Serve as a clinical liaison for the graduate program and intermediary between students, agencies and practitioners in the community.
  4. Input data and maintain accurate records regarding clinical placements in consultation with Track Coordinators.
  5. Establish and maintain relationships with representatives of agencies where students are placed or desire a placement.
  6. Initiate the process for all clinical student affiliation contracts and academic contracts and bring same to finalization for the graduate program.

REQUIREMENTS
Bachelor’s degree in Nursing with 3 years of clinical experience; Proficient in computer skills and data base entry and maintenance; Excellent written and verbal communication skills; Ability to multi-task and prioritize; Ability to work independently with minimal supervision; Excellent organizational skills and detail oriented. Additional related professional experience may be substituted for the degree on a year-to-year basis.
